About Henry Metzger Middle

Henry Metzger Middle School serves 907 students in grades 6 through 8 in San Antonio, offering a substantial middle school experience with a student-teacher ratio of 14.2:1 and 64 full-time equivalent teachers. The school currently ranks #3757 out of 8598 schools statewide, placing it in the 56th percentile among Texas schools, with room for continued academic growth and development. Community Profile

The community surrounding Henry Metzger Middle has a median household income of $67,789. It is a community where 24%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$195,400, with a median rent of $1,552/month. The area has a poverty rate of 10.5%. The average commute for residents is 25 minutes.
